US Navy Orders Fourth America Class Amphibious Assault Ship
Released on Thursday, April 30, 2020

 

Huntington Ingalls Industries, Pascagoula, Mississippi, is awarded an $187,469,732 not-to-exceed undefinitized contract action for long lead time material and associated engineering and design activities in support of one Amphibious Assault Ship Replacement (LHA(R)) Flight 1 Ship and LHA 9. Work will be performed in Pascagoula, Mississippi (33%); Beloit, Wisconsin (23%); Brunswick, Georgia (21%); King of Prussia, Pennsylvania (11%); York, Pennsylvania (10%); Brampton, Ontario, Canada (1%); and Hurahan, Louisiana (1%). Work to be performed is the procurement of long lead time material for LHA 9, the fourth LHA (R) America Class and the second LHA(R) Flight 1 ship. Work is expected to be complete by February 2024. Fiscal 2019 shipbuilding and conversion, (Navy) funding in the amount of $187,469,732 will be obligated at award and will not expire at the end of the current fiscal year. The Naval Sea Systems Command, Washington, D.C., is the contracting activity (N00024-20-C-2437).
